AHR REGLAN 5
Generic Name: metoclopramide
Pill imprint AHR REGLAN 5 has been identified as Reglan 5 MG.
Reglan is used in the treatment of nausea/vomiting; gastroparesis; migraine; gerd; nausea/vomiting, postoperative (and more), and belongs to the drug classes GI stimulants, miscellaneous antiemetics. There is no proven risk in humans during pregnancy.
Reglan 5 MG is not subject to the Controlled Substances Act.
